PHP-Anmeldeskriptcode und Tutorial

Jan / Getty
Wir werden ein einfaches Anmeldesystem mit PHP-Code auf unseren Seiten und eine MySQL-Datenbank zum Speichern der Informationen unserer Benutzer erstellen. Wir werden die Benutzer verfolgen, mit denen Sie angemeldet sind Kekse .
01 von 07Die Datenbank
Bevor wir ein Anmeldeskript erstellen können, müssen wir dies zunächst tun eine Datenbank erstellen Benutzer zu speichern. Für dieses Tutorial benötigen wir lediglich die Felder „Benutzername“ und „Passwort“, Sie können jedoch beliebig viele Felder erstellen.
|_+_|
Dadurch wird eine Datenbank namens erstellt Benutzer mit 3 Feldern: ID, Benutzername und Passwort.
02 von 07Anmeldeseite 1
|_+_|Dieses Skript prüft zunächst, ob die Anmeldeinformationen in einem Cookie auf dem Computer des Benutzers enthalten sind. Wenn dies der Fall ist, versucht es, sie anzumelden. Wenn dies erfolgreich ist, sind sie es umgeleitet zum Mitgliederbereich.
Wenn kein Cookie vorhanden ist, ermöglicht es ihnen, sich anzumelden. Wenn das Formular gesendet wurde, gleicht es es mit der Datenbank ab, und wenn es erfolgreich war, setzt es ein Cookie und führt sie zum Mitgliederbereich. Wenn es nicht gesendet wurde, zeigt es ihnen das Anmeldeformular.
06 von 07Mitgliederbereich
|_+_|Dieser Code überprüft unsere Cookies, um sicherzustellen, dass der Benutzer angemeldet ist, genauso wie es die Anmeldeseite getan hat. Sind sie eingeloggt, wird ihnen der Mitgliederbereich angezeigt. Wenn sie nicht angemeldet sind, werden sie auf die Anmeldeseite umgeleitet.
07 von 07Abmeldeseite
|_+_|Unsere Abmeldeseite zerstört lediglich das Cookie und leitet sie dann zurück zur Anmeldeseite. Wir zerstören das Cookie, indem wir das Ablaufdatum auf einen Zeitpunkt in der Vergangenheit setzen.